@Natalia I want to revive this since it’s a new year. We just started switching our teams to using Asana and we’re still getting adjusted. We’re about 2 weeks in and I’ve been playing with how to organize things the most efficient way for us still. I just thought about “folders” this morning and found this thread. It’d be so great to have this. Because we can have video, graphics, and web projects all for one client. It’s weird having them all under one project. But if we could have a folder that would contain all of those projects that’d make things wonderfully. Thanks!
